Knowledge heart expansion in focal point
AMD’s knowledge heart trade was once in focal point when the corporate reported its This fall effects. The section’s income surged 69% yr over yr and 11% sequentially to $3.9 billion. Each AMD’s Intuition graphics processing gadgets (GPUs) and EPYC central processing gadgets (CPUs) helped pressure the expansion. On the other hand, analysts had been anticipating knowledge heart income to be $4.14 billion, as compiled by means of FactSet.
The corporate mentioned that its EPYC CPUs proceed to realize marketplace percentage within the knowledge heart. Amongst hyperscalers, AMD now has a marketplace percentage smartly above 50% for its EPYC CPUs. In the meantime, AMD mentioned Microsoft and Meta Platforms are each the use of its MI300X GPUs. It mentioned it’s seeing sturdy hobby in its next-generation MI350 collection GPUs, which it plans to ramp up round mid-year. AMD will release its MI400 GPUs in 2026.
AMD’s shopper section, in the meantime, additionally grew strongly, with This fall income hiking 58% yr over yr to $2.3 billion. AMD mentioned it persevered to realize marketplace percentage within the private pc (PC) retail house, together with having over 70% marketplace percentage on common platforms similar to Amazon, Newegg, and MindFactory. It’s having a look to outpace PC marketplace expansion in 2025, which it sees emerging by means of mid-single digits. The corporate persevered to peer weak spot in its online game and embedded segments. Gaming section income plunged 59% to $563 million as its consumers Microsoft and Sony labored on normalizing stock. Embedded gross sales fell by means of 13%, harm by means of weaknesses in business and conversation markets.
General, AMD’s This fall income jumped by means of 24% yr over yr to $7.66 billion. Adjusted EPS, in the meantime, soared 42% to $1.09. That beat the analyst consensus for EPS of $1.08 on income of $7.53 billion, as compiled by means of LSEG.
Adjusted gross margins rose 320 foundation issues to 54%. This presentations that the corporate is not only rising income however that its income is changing into extra winning as smartly.
For the quarter, AMD generated loose money drift of $1.1 billion and and $2.4 billion for the total yr. It ended 2024 with web money and momentary investments of $5.1 billion and $1.7 billion in debt.
Having a look forward, the corporate guided for Q1 income of between $6.8 billion to $7.4 billion. That will constitute expansion of 30% on the midpoint, appearing persevered income expansion acceleration. The expansion shall be powered by means of sturdy expansion in its knowledge heart and shopper companies, offsetting an important decline in its gaming trade and a modest decline in its embedded trade.
For the total yr, it forecast double-digit proportion income and EPS expansion yr over yr. It sees each its gaming and embedded segments having modest expansion.

Will have to traders purchase the dip?
AMD could be very not going to make any large inroads in opposition to rival Nvidia within the knowledge heart GPU marketplace. The corporate simply does no longer have the tool platform to compete in opposition to Nvidia’s dominance, particularly in coaching. The corporate has carved a good area of interest in AI inference as a viable selection and must proceed to peer GPU expansion because of this.
On the other hand, as a substitute of viewing AMD as a GPU afterthought, possibly it is best to view the corporate because the main knowledge heart CPU corporate. That is the world the place AMD has been thriving and taking marketplace percentage. CPUs aren’t as large an element as GPUs when development out AI infrastructure, however they nonetheless play the most important function, and AMD is seeing sturdy expansion because of this. The corporate could also be gaining percentage within the PC marketplace as smartly.
From a valuation standpoint, AMD trades at a ahead price-to-earnings ratio (P/E) of beneath 24 occasions 2025 analyst estimates, with 41% EPS expansion projected. That is a slightly horny valuation.
When you assume AMD goes to be the following large GPU winner, you’ll be able to most certainly finally end up being upset. If you wish to play the GPU marketplace and its expanding computing energy wishes, Nvidia remains to be the most suitable choice. On the other hand, if you’ll recognize AMD for its sturdy place in CPUs and its expansion on this house, then the inventory looks as if a forged choice to shop for in this dip.
